Black and white image with words, "The sum of two opposite integers equals zero".

Provides classroom activities for middle school math teachers to help students build a better understanding of addition and multiplication of integers, a skill necessary for success in algebra. Uses examples that incorporate both number lines and concrete models. Instructs how to add on a number line and add with manipulatives. Introduces and models multiplication of integers using a concrete model. Provides examples of problems with a positive leading factor and a negative leading factor. Uses concrete model of multiplication to explain why multiplying two negative numbers equals a positive product.
